"America" is a book of poems about growing up in the Bronx in the 1940s, as well as poems through the 20th and 21st centuries; it explores America through different periods of the poet's life. The poems, through the twentieth century, confront a changing America. In the present, the poet reflects on spring, home, and love. >Figurative language, sharp images, and a love of metaphor make the poems work.
